Myriad Products is seeking an Engineering Project Manager to lead renewable energy projects from contract award through to completion. Based in Melton Mowbray, you will manage multiple projects including solar PV and other renewable technologies, ensuring delivery on time and within compliance.
Candidates should hold a relevant engineering degree and have proven experience in managing commercial solar projects. This hybrid role offers a clear growth path into leadership and direct interactions with senior leadership.
